RESOLUTION NO. 6226
A RESOLUTION O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F CYPRESS'
APPROVING CONDITIONAL USE PERMIT NO. 2010-11
- WITH CONDITIONS.
TH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F CYPRESS HEREBY FINDS, RESOLVES,
DETERMINES, AND ORDERS AS FOLLOWS:
1. That an application was filed for a conditional use permit in accordance with
the provisions of Section 4.19.070 of the Zoning Ordinance of the City of Cypress to allow
a massage establishment providing only hand and foot reflexology, as well as chair
massage services located at 4171 Ball Road within the CG- 10,000 Commercial General
Zone.
2. That the City Council, after proper notice thereof, duly held a public hearing
on said application as provided by law.
3. That the City Council hereby finds that:
a. The proposed location of the conditional use is in accord with the
objectives of the Zoning Ordinance and the purpose of the CG- 10,000 Commercial
General Zone in which the site is located, which is:
Intended to serve the daily shopping needs of the community,
including shopping centers which may be anchored by large -scale
retail outlets, entertainment uses, hotels, and restaurants. The CG
zoning district is consistent with the General Neighborhood
Commercial land use designation of the Cypress General Plan.
b. The proposed location of the conditional use and the conditions under
which it would be operated or maintained will not be detrimental to the public
health, safety or welfare, or be materially injurious to properties or improvements in
the vicinity in that:
(1) The proposed massage use providing only hand and foot
reflexology, as well as chair massage services is conditionally permitted in
the applicable CG- 10,000 Commercial General Zone and is consistent with
the Cypress General Plan's General Neighborhood Commercial land use
designation.
(2) The subject site contains a sufficient number of parking
spaces to accommodate both the proposed and existing uses located within
the existing shopping center.
(3) As conditioned, the proposed massage use providing only
hand and foot reflexology, as well as chair massage services would be
compatible with surrounding commercial and residential land uses.
(4) Conditions of approval shall restrict the massage business
operations to prevent noise impacts on adjacent residential properties.
(5) Standard conditions of approval have been imposed to ensure
compliance with the Cypress City Code and other applicable regulations.
c. The proposed conditional use will comply with each of the applicable
provisions of the Cypress Zoning Ordinance, as well as the massage ordinance of
the Cypress City Code.
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that the City Council of the
City of Cypress does hereby approve Conditional Use Permit No. 2010 -11, subject to the
conditions attached hereto as Exhibit "A ".
PASSED AND ADOPTED by the City Council of the City of Cypress at a regular
meeting held on the 8th day of November, 2010.

EXHIBIT "A"
CONDITIONAL USE PERMIT NO. 2010-11
4171 BALL ROAD
CONDITIONS OF APPROVAL
Notes:
Regular text denotes standard conditions of approval.
Bolded conditions represent those specific to this project.
GENERAL CONDITIONS
1. Unless and until the project applicant and property owner sign and return a City - provided affidavit
accepting these conditions of approval, there shall be no entitlement of the application. The
project applicant and property owner shall have fifteen (15) calendar days to return the signed
affidavit to the Community Development Department. Failure to do so will render City Council
action on the application void.
2. The developer shall defend, indemnify, and hold harmless, the City and any agency thereof, or any
of its agents, officers, and employees from any and all claims, actions, or proceedings against the
City or any agency thereof, or any of its agents, officers or employees, to attack, set aside, void or
annul, an approval of the City, or any agency thereof, advisory agency, appeal board, or legislative
body, including actions approved by the voters of the City, concerning the project, which action is
brought within the time period provided in Government Code Section 66499.37 and Public
Resources Code, Division 13, CH. 4 (§ 21000 et sec . - including but not by way of limitation §
21152 and 21167). City shall promptly notify the developer of any claim, action, or proceeding
brought within this time period.
3. The applicant/developer shall comply with all provisions of the Code of the City of Cypress.
4. All requirements of the Orange County Fire Marshal's Office, Orange County Health Department,
and Cypress Building and Safety Division shall be satisfied prior to commencement of the
business operation.
5. The applicant shall obtain a Cypress business license prior to commencement of the business
operation.
6. All applicable conditions of Conditional Use Permit No. 2010 -11 shall be complied with prior to
occupancy of the subject building.
7. All business activity shall occur within the building. Temporary use permits may be granted for
outdoor activity in accordance with Section 35, Division 10, of the Cypress Zoning Ordinance.
8. Within forty -eight (48) hours of the approval of this project, the applicant/developer shall deliver
to the Community Development Department a check payable to the County Clerk- Recorder in
the amount of Fifty Dollars ($50.00) County administrative fee, to enable the City to file the
Notice of Exemption pursuant to Fish and Game Code §711.4 and California Code of Regulations,
Title 14, section 753.5. If, within such forty -eight (48) hour period, the applicant/developer has not
delivered to the Community Development Department the check required above, the approval for
the project granted herein shall be void.

9. Any and all correction notice(s) generated through the tenant improvement plan check and/or
inspection process is /are hereby incorporated by reference as conditions of approval and shall
be fully complied with by the owner, applicant and all agents thereof.
COMMUNITY DEVELOPMENT CONDITIONS
10. The approved use shall include foot and hand reflexology, as well as chair massage. Any
expansion or modification of the approved use beyond what is approved as part of Conditional
Use Permit No. 2010 -11 (such as full body massage) shall require an amendment to the
conditional use permit.
11. This conditional use permit may be modified or revoked by the City Council should the Council
determine that the proposed use or conditions under which it is being operated or maintained is
detrimental to the public health, safety, or welfare, or materially injurious to properties or
improvements in the vicinity.
12. Interior tenant improvement plans for the subject lease area shall be reviewed and approved by the
Community Development Department prior to the issuance of building permits.
13. All interior improvements to the subject lease area shall be constructed as illustrated on plans
submitted to the City.
14. The developer shall not erect or display on the subject property any signs which have not been
approved in writing by the Community Development Department.
15. Upon expiration or termination of the tenant's lease term, the tenant or property owner shall
remove all wall signs, patch the canopy and fascia, and paint the patched area to match the
surrounding wall fascia. This painted area shall constitute the entire wall of the tenant space or
entire building if there are no screed lines or architectural projections to provide a clear line of
demarcation.
16. All product and material storage shall occur within the building. Exterior storage is specifically
prohibited.
17. Outside public address speakers, telephone bells, buzzers and similar devices which are audible on
adjoining properties are hereby prohibited.
18. The City Council shall maintain the right to review the business' hours of operation and may,
subject to a public hearing, limit the business hours should substantiated complaints be received
that the business hours are creating an adverse impact upon neighboring properties.
19. Deliveries shall be from 9 a.m. — 9 p.m. only.

20. The access door to the business premises facing the alleyway and adjoining residential uses shall
remain closed during all hours of business operation. A sign shall be attached to the inside of said
door to post this requirement.
21. Should substantiated complaints be received, this conditional use permit may be modified and/or
revoked, subject to a public hearing.
22. The business owner /operator of the massage establishment shall be responsible for
maintaining compliance of the massage establishment with all applicable provisions of the
massage ordinance of the Cypress City Code (Chapter 15A).
23. The business owner /operator of the massage establishment shall be responsible for the
conduct of all employees or independent contractors working on the premises of the business
(California Business and Professional Code, Division 2, Chapter 10.5, Massage Therapists, §
4612 (c)).
24. Pursuant to the City's massage ordinance, the massage establishment shall not be open for
business between the hours of 9:00 p.m. and 7:00 a.m. (Cypress City Code § 15A- 7(n)).
25. Any and all investigating officials of the City shall have the right to enter the massage
establishment from time to time during regular business hours to make reasonable
inspections to observe and enforce compliance with building, fire, electrical, plumbing or
health regulations, and to ascertain whether there is compliance with the applicable
provisions of the City's massage ordinance (Cypress City Code § 15A -9).
26. The owner /operator of the massage establishment shall notify the City of any intention to
rename, change management, or convey the business to another person. A sale or transfer
of any interest in the massage establishment shall be reported to the City within ten (10)
days of such sale or transfer. The new owner(s) of interest shall comply with the massage
ordinance provisions for said sale or transfer (Cypress City Code § 15A -13).
BUILDING CONDITIONS
27. Applicant/developer shall obtain the required permits and comply with applicable provisions of
the 2007 California Building, Plumbing, Electrical, and Mechanical Codes, the 2007 California
Administrative Code, Title 24, and the Code of the City of Cypress.
